To get mold out of the fabric of your stroller, … WebMay 15, 2024 · To clean off mold from porous surfaces like wood and drywall, a detergent should be added to a bleach and water solution to … WebMar 9, 2024 · You can remove mold from fabric without using any harsh chemicals. Here’s how: Start by vacuum ing the piece of furniture to remove any loose mold spores. Then, mix together equal parts water and white vinegar in a bowl. Dip a clean rag into the mixture and use it to scrub away the mold. Rinse the area with clean water when you’re finished. play paper io 2 teams mode
